This allows for greater expressiveness, whether when playing unrestrained, or when attempting more subtler nuances. You can even use the Pedal Closed Hi-hat and Pedal Open hi-hat techniques. • When a Hi-hat Control Pedal (FD-7; sold separately) is connected, you gain continuous control (from closed to open) over the Hi-hat sounds. • Using the PD-7 or PD-9 Pads allows vou to use playing techniques such as rim shots and cymbal chokes (whereby the cymbal is struck and then grabbed bv hand to cut off the sound). • The interval between striking a Pad and production of the sound is a fast 0.003 second. Simple operation • You can switch instantly to any of the 32 Patches (Drum Sets) available. • Even players unfamiliar with electronic instruments can start playing immediately. • The TD-5 is designed so it is equipped with only the needed functions, thus creating a streamlined design. Eight Trigger Input jacks (stereo) Provides high-quality reverb Includes a metronome function, helpful for practicing Equipped with jacks that increase the TD-5’s usefulness • The AUX IN jack lets you mix sounds with a headphone stereo or other audio device (The mix can be heard only through headphones.). • The PATCH SHIFT jack allows vou to connect a foot switch for changing Patches up or down. • When one or more Drum Triggers is connected to the TRIGGER INPUT jacks, the TD-5 can function as an acoustic trigger..to - MIDI interface.
